Output c0711090d0a64ddb7a8dbce5f1a81ab8035526cc50338747c61b52d692389470:1

value
20508475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8a80d352e0d38b19fc6b09426ee64c94a95d61 OP_EQUAL
address
MDbr3hM2RQsYPyDwWkhNcTpzXcUpYBQ2hD
transaction
c0711090d0a64ddb7a8dbce5f1a81ab8035526cc50338747c61b52d692389470
spent
true